After experiencing significant challenges over the past few years, including the COVID-19 pandemic and the downgrade by the United States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) to Category 2, the future of Mexico´s aviation industry finally looks bright. The country recovered the FAA’s Category 1 ranking in September while passenger volumes surpassed 2019 levels by almost 10%.
